Is the use of Amikanit 100 Injection safe for pregnant women?
Amikanit can cause severe side effects if taken during pregnancy, so, pregnant women should talk to their doctor before taking it.
Is the use of Amikanit 100 Injection safe during breastfeeding?
Due to lack of research work on this topic, the side effects of Amikanit for breastfeeding women are not known.
What is the effect of Amikanit 100 Injection on the Kidneys?
Effects of Amikanit on kidney can be severe. It is not safe to use it without doctor's advice.
What is the effect of Amikanit 100 Injection on the Liver?
Side effects of Amikanit rarely affect the liver.
What is the effect of Amikanit 100 Injection on the Heart?
Side effects of Amikanit rarely affect the heart.

Amikanit can be safely taken as prescribed by your doctor. Do not discontinue the medicine suddenly or take it longer than prescribed duration.
No, Amikanit is not available in tablet form. It is available in only injectable dosage form either given by intramuscularly or intravenously depends on patient condition or severity of infections.
Discontinuing Amikanit on your own can increase the chances of bacterial resistance and infection relapse. It is recommended that you always consult your doctor if you have decided to discontinue this medicine.
No, Amikanit does not cause constipation in patients who are taking it. However, if you are experiencing constipation after taking this drug then inform your doctor and take precautionary methods such as eating fibrous foods to avoid constipation.
Do not self-administer Amikanit. It comes in the form of injection and given preferably 2 - 3 times in a day (Intravenously). Discontinuing the medicine in between may promote resistant bacteria which result in a relapse of the infection. You are recommended to complete the 7 - 10 days course even after getting symptomatic relief. In case you feel any discomfort such as hearing loss and nephrotoxicity while taking Amikanit please inform your doctor immediately.
